Evaluation by Hearing Acuity and Some Characteristics of Sound
Investigation on Welding Arc Sound (Report 2)

Abstract

In this paper we describe an experimental study of evaluation by hearing acuity, undesired sound and some characteristics of welding arc sound.
The results obtained are summerized as follows:
1) We can discern the arc voltage difference by hearing of variable welding arc sound within proper arc voltage.
2) NRN of welding arc sound is 78 in CO2 arc welding and 85 in MIG arc welding of 400A. Then, it is often necessary to protect the organ of hearing from undesired sound of high current welding and impulse welding.
3) Welding arc sound is constituted from wide-band random signal and sine signal of ripple frequency of power source. Intensity of the sine signal emphasized in a Globular and Spray transfer region with increaseing arc voltage.
4) Welding arc sound is remarkably affected by change of droplet transfer and it has the stability in wide region with proper arc voltage. But sound pressure level is the smallest when the arc voltage is larger than proper one.
5) The 707Hz-2245Hz bandwidth is an important frequency region of welding arc sound and in this bandwidth we can get some informations of arc voltage, gas shielding and electrode extension.
